Dating Confidence Reset
Start by clarifying what you want and what you won’t accept. Write down a short list of nonnegotiables (values, deal-breakers) and a separate list of nice-to-haves. That makes it easier to spot compatible matches and avoid wasting time on conversations that won’t lead anywhere.
Slow the pace to stay grounded. Treat early messages as discovery, not commitment: ask two clear questions, share one genuine detail about yourself, and give the other person space to respond. A steady rhythm helps you judge interest without tumbling into anxious messaging or ghost-chasing.
Keep expectations realistic. Online dating is a filter, not an instant outcome. Expect some mismatches and polite fades; that’s normal. What matters is whether interactions move toward something you actually want — a thoughtful chat, a video call, or an in-person meet-up — not how many matches you collect.
Measure progress by small wins. Notice when a conversation stays reciprocal for more than a few messages, when someone follows through on a plan, or when you feel curious instead of drained. Celebrate clarity and consistency rather than waiting for perfection.
Practice respectful boundaries and self-respect. If a message makes you uncomfortable or someone repeatedly cancels, step back. You can pause conversations without guilt and prioritize people who show reliability and mutual interest.
Be selective with your energy. Use quick profile checks to focus on cues that matter to you: shared values, clear photos, and complete bios. Fewer thoughtful replies are more valuable than many lukewarm exchanges.
Finally, keep the bigger picture in view. Dating is one part of life, not the whole of it. Stay curious, stay patient, and treat each interaction as data that helps refine what you want — that steady practice builds confidence over time.
